Evergreen Man Charged with Homicide in 2-Year-Old Boy’s Death

Brandon Lee Walter Newberry was arrested and charged with deliberate homicide

By Justin Franz

A 21-year-old Evergreen man has been charged with deliberate homicide in the death of his girlfriend’s 2-year-old son.

According to the Flathead County Sheriff’s Office, Brandon Lee Walter Newberry was arrested and charged with the death of Forrest Groshelle after law enforcement responded on Tuesday to the couple’s home and found the child dead.

According to court documents, the Flathead County Sheriff’s Office received a call about an unresponsive child on Feb. 17. During the call, Newberry could be heard screaming in the background, “it’s my fault, it’s my fault.”

When police arrived, they found bruising, scratching and abrasions on Groshelle’s body. An autopsy revealed that the child had been hit multiple times in the abdomen, causing perienteritis, a laceration of the small intestine.

In an interview with sheriff’s deputies, the mother revealed that Newberry had been watching Groshelle on a daily basis while she was at work. The mother also said that her son had been vomiting since Feb. 12, suggesting that the assault may have occurred between Feb. 11 and 17, according to police. During an interview with police, Newberry admitted that he had been “roughhousing” with the child the previous day.

Newberry is scheduled to appear in court on Feb. 26. If convicted, Newberry could face up to 100 years in prison.

A candle light vigil is being held to honor Groshelle on Friday at 7 p.m. in Lawrence Park.
